The Core Promise of an AI Bookmark Manager
At its heart, an AI bookmark manager redefines how we interact with saved information. Gone are the days of manual categorization, endless scrolling, and the frustration of “I know I saved that somewhere!” These tools leverage sophisticated artificial intelligence to transform your unstructured collection of links into a dynamically organized, intelligent knowledge base.
Automated Tagging and Categorization
This is perhaps the most immediate and impactful benefit. Instead of you spending precious time assigning tags or creating folders, an AI bookmark manager automatically analyzes the content of a saved link. It uses NLP (Natural Language Processing) and advanced machine learning models to:
- Extract Key Entities: Identifying people, organizations, locations, and specific concepts mentioned in the text.
- Infer Topics and Themes: Understanding the overarching subject matter, even if it’s not explicitly stated.
- Suggest or Apply Tags: Automatically applying relevant tags that make sense for that specific piece of content, often drawing from a vast, dynamic ontology rather than just your predefined categories.
This level of automation means your saved items are consistently and intelligently categorized, making them discoverable in ways you never thought possible.
Semantic Search and Contextual Retrieval
Forget keyword-matching. Traditional search engines and bookmark managers only find results where your search terms explicitly appear. AI bookmark managers, however, harness the power of semantic search.
- Understanding Intent: They comprehend the meaning and intent behind your query, not just the words themselves.
- Vector Embeddings: Content is transformed into high-dimensional numerical representations (vector embeddings) that capture its semantic meaning. When you search, your query is also converted into an embedding, and the system finds content with “contextual proximity” within a vector database search.
- Retrieval-Augmented Generation (RAG): Some advanced tools integrate RAG architectures, meaning they can retrieve relevant snippets from your saved links and then use a generative AI model to synthesize answers or summarize information based on that retrieved context. This is incredibly powerful for complex research questions.
This means you can ask questions in natural language, and the system will return relevant results even if the exact words of your query aren’t present in the saved content. For example, searching “best practices for remote team leadership” might pull up an article titled “Driving Engagement in Hybrid Workloads” because the AI understands the semantic relationship between the concepts.
AI-Powered Summarization and Content Extraction
Who has time to read every single article they save? AI bookmark managers can now provide instant gratification:
- Automated Summaries: Generating concise summaries of long articles, PDFs, or even video transcripts, allowing you to quickly grasp the core ideas without reading the full text.
- Key Takeaway Extraction: Identifying and highlighting the most important points or action items.
- Image and Media Analysis: Some tools can even analyze images within an article, extracting text, identifying objects, or understanding visual context to enhance searchability.
Duplicate Detection and Content Curation
No more saving the same link five times! Advanced AI can identify duplicate content, even if the URLs are slightly different or if the same article appears on multiple domains. This keeps your library clean and efficient. Furthermore, some systems can intelligently suggest related content you’ve already saved, helping you build more robust “knowledge clusters” around specific topics.

The Underlying Technology: How AI Powers Automatic Organization
The magic behind these AI bookmark managers isn’t just a clever algorithm; it’s a symphony of advanced computational linguistics and machine learning techniques working in harmony.
Natural Language Processing (NLP)
NLP is the foundation. It allows machines to “read” and “understand” human language. When you save a link, NLP models:
- Tokenization: Breaking text into individual words or sub-word units.
- Part-of-Speech Tagging: Identifying nouns, verbs, adjectives, etc.
- Named Entity Recognition (NER): Recognizing and classifying specific entities like names of people, organizations, locations, dates, and products. This is crucial for automatic tagging.
- Sentiment Analysis: Determining the emotional tone or overall sentiment of a piece of text (e.g., positive, negative, neutral).
Machine Learning (ML) and Deep Learning
ML algorithms, especially deep learning neural networks, are trained on vast datasets to learn patterns in language and content. This enables them to:
- Classification: Categorizing content into predefined or emergent topics and themes (e.g., “Tech News,” “Recipe,” “Research Paper”).
- Clustering: Grouping similar content together without explicit instruction (e.g., automatically discovering a cluster of articles about “quantum computing advancements”).
- Summarization: Using either extractive methods (pulling key sentences) or abstractive methods (generating new sentences that capture the essence) to create concise summaries.
Vector Embeddings and Vector Databases for Semantic Search
This is where “smart search” truly comes into play. Instead of just keywords:
- Embeddings: Text, images, and even audio are converted into high-dimensional numerical vectors. These vectors capture the meaning and context of the content. Semantically similar items will have vector embeddings that are “close” to each other in this multi-dimensional space.
- Vector Database Search: When you perform a search query, it’s also converted into a vector. A vector database then rapidly searches for and retrieves content whose vectors are most similar to your query’s vector, based on a distance metric (like cosine similarity). This allows for highly relevant results, even if your query doesn’t match exact keywords in the original content.
- Contextual Proximity: This refers to how close the “meaning” of your query is to the “meaning” of your saved content, as represented by their respective vector embeddings. This powers the ability to search by concept rather than just keywords.
Retrieval-Augmented Generation (RAG)
Some of the more advanced AI bookmark managers are starting to incorporate RAG. This technique combines the “retrieval” power of semantic search with the “generation” capabilities of large language models (LLMs). The system first retrieves highly relevant information from your saved bookmarks (using vector search) and then uses an LLM to synthesize this information into a coherent answer or detailed summary. This makes your personal knowledge base incredibly powerful for answering complex, nuanced questions.
Model Context Protocol (MCP) Endpoints
Looking ahead, sophisticated AI bookmark managers are developing MCP endpoints. These allow other AI agents (like personal assistants, research bots, or custom LLMs) to directly interface with your saved knowledge base. Imagine an AI agent autonomously browsing your saved articles and synthesizing reports based on your command, or answering questions by pulling context directly from your bookmarks. This shifts the paradigm from simply organizing data to actively querying and leveraging it with other AI tools.
